📋 Should Businesses Involve Employees in Decision-Making Processes?

🌐 Understanding the Importance

In modern management, employee inclusion in decision-making processes bridges the gap between leadership goals and operational realities, fostering trust and innovation. Companies with participative leadership models often experience higher engagement, creativity, and organizational alignment.

📊 Achievements and Challenges

🏆 Achievements

  • Enhanced Innovation: Companies like Google thrive on employee-driven ideas, boosting creativity and problem-solving.
  • 📈 Improved Productivity: Research indicates 21% higher profitability in organizations with engaged employees (Gallup, 2023).
  • 🤝 Stronger Trust and Retention: Employee inclusion fosters a sense of ownership, reducing attrition rates.

⚠️ Challenges

  • 🐌 Slower Decision-Making: Involving multiple stakeholders can delay critical decisions, affecting agility.
  • 💥 Potential Conflicts: Differing opinions may create friction in traditional hierarchical structures.
  • 📉 Risk of Inefficiency: Without structured frameworks, participative models can lead to confusion and indecisiveness.

🌍 Global Comparisons

  • 🇩🇪 Germany’s Co-Determination Model: Employee representation on company boards enhances trust and decision quality.
  • 🇯🇵 Japan’s Consensus-Based Approach: Encourages collective agreement, promoting harmony and inclusivity.

🔮 Future Outlook

Businesses can leverage technology to balance inclusivity and efficiency. Collaborative tools like Trello and Slack streamline workflows, while structured feedback systems optimize decision-making. Leadership training programs can empower managers to balance diverse perspectives and drive decisive action.
